Description

The vulnerability allows a local user to disclose sensitive information.

The vulnerability exists due to improper link resolution before file access in avatar handling when resolving local avatar paths. A local user can create a symlink path that resolves outside the configured workspace boundary to disclose sensitive information.

Only files readable by the OpenClaw process can be exposed via gateway avatar surfaces.
